If you own an old-fashioned cheap car key replacement key, you can replace it by contacting a local locksmith or dealership for automobiles. However, the process at the dealership can take time and the locksmith's services are usually less expensive. Based on the model and make, an automotive locksmith can also assist you in programming the new key to work with the lock system of your vehicle. You'll need evidence of ownership, such as the title or registration. Some locksmiths can make keys for your car for you right on the spot, while others will need to take the key back to their shop in order to do so. This can take from 20 minutes to an hour, so be sure you have the proper documents with you.

Transponder Keys

Many cars manufactured after the 1990s have a transponder in the key. This stops car thieves from hotwiring your vehicle. If you lose a key with a transponder chip you must replace it as soon as possible since the car won't start without it.

It's not difficult, if you have a spare key. You can take it to an automotive locksmith to get them to clone your key for a lower price than the price a dealer would charge. If you want to save some money then you can do it yourself. However it is more complex and requires some expertise to do properly.

The key can serve as a replacement for the ignition, but it will not be able to start the engine. It is not a replacement for the ignition, since you require the transponder to send a signal to the immobilizer system in your car to turn on the motor.

The chip in the key transmits an radio frequency signal to the immobilizer once it is placed inside the ignition cylinder. The immobilizer makes sure that the code on the chip matches the one it needs in order to allow the vehicle to start. If the chip in the key doesn't match, the engine will remain idle and won't turn over.

A professional can program a new key for your vehicle by sending an indication to the chip inside the key that is in line with the immobilizer's code. The technician will then erase the previous key to ensure that your vehicle can only accept the newly programmed key.
